Default Sturgeon Fishing Southern Alberta

New to sturgeon fishing, the kids are bugging me to go when the season opens next week. Is it too early to go for them? The river level is very low. Just wondering if a person should wait for the snow to start melting and raise the level? Thanks for your advice.

You can catch them on opening day, but won't be big numbers yet. Use the river level app and go crazy when the water level starts to rise rapidly. How far south? Usually get a few opening day in Lethbridge area
